Satellite Systems San Diego

Dish Doctor

Address
3287 F St #I
Place
San Diego , CA 92102-3329
Landline
(619) 239-4882

Description

Dish Doctor can be found at 3287 F St #I . The following is offered: Satellite Systems - In San Diego there are 8 other Satellite Systems.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Satellite Systems
(619)239-4882 (619)-239-4882 +16192394882

Map 3287 F St #I